Massachusetts is the economic engine of New England and a critical node in the Northeast freight network. The Port of Boston handles containerized cargo and is the primary maritime gateway for all six New England states. The I-90 Massachusetts Turnpike connects Boston to Albany and the Midwest, while I-93 and I-95 channel freight through the densely populated greater Boston metro area. Springfield and Worcester serve as inland distribution hubs that feed consumer goods to communities across the region.

Major Massachusetts Freight Corridors

Hanksugi tires are engineered for the routes that keep Massachusetts commerce moving

I-90 Mass Turnpike

The Massachusetts Turnpike is the state's primary east-west corridor, connecting Boston to Springfield and the New York state line. This toll road carries transcontinental freight, regional distribution, and intermodal traffic, making it one of New England's most critical commercial routes.

I-93 Boston North-South

Running through the heart of Boston from Braintree to New Hampshire, I-93 is the primary north-south freight artery for eastern Massachusetts. Heavy congestion and the notorious bottleneck through downtown Boston demand tires that handle constant speed variation and frequent braking.

I-95 Coastal Corridor

The I-95 corridor through Massachusetts connects Providence to the New Hampshire border, serving the northeastern seaboard freight network. Distribution centers along the Route 128 technology corridor and North Shore industrial areas generate substantial commercial traffic.

I-495 Outer Belt

The I-495 loop serves Massachusetts's suburban distribution hub, with major fulfillment centers and biotech facilities in Devens, Westborough, and Taunton. This corridor has become the preferred location for large-scale logistics operations serving all of New England.

Industries We Serve in Massachusetts

Port of Boston

The Port of Boston at Conley Terminal handles containerized imports serving all of New England. Drayage fleets move containers between the port and distribution centers across the region. Tires must handle heavy container loads, terminal yard conditions, and the transition to congested Boston area highways.

Biotech & Pharmaceuticals

The Route 128 and I-495 corridors host the nation's densest concentration of biotech and pharmaceutical companies. Temperature-controlled pharmaceutical shipments require absolute tire reliability. These high-value loads cannot tolerate roadside delays that compromise cargo integrity.

Regional Distribution

Massachusetts serves as the distribution gateway for all six New England states. Major retailers, grocery chains, and e-commerce operations base their New England fulfillment centers along I-495 and I-90.
